M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
studies
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
advances in
online education technology have enabled
learners
all over the world
to take part in classes online.
Massively open online courses are
customarily free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
issues that
distance learning organizations
have to deal with
in 2015 because technology-enhanced learning is
developing so swiftly.
How can participants
make sure that
the instruction provided by these
massive open online courses is
satisfactory?
How can learners
be assured that
educators are properly credentialed
to teach online classes?
What business models are being used by
organizations like
Georgia Institute of Technology to conduct these massively open online courses?
What original teaching practices and assessment strategies are optimal?
How can institutions
handle issues like
inadequate
student motivation and high
attrition?
As digital education technology becomes more
procurable there is a
increasing
need
to better understand how
massively open online courses are being conducted.
Lecturers
and numerous other
participants
desire
to better grasp
the outcomes of these
promising new open educational
ventures.
Trainers want
to comprehend how
these MOOC courses
can be made better.
In response to this
expanding
demand for
knowledge
the scholarly new book
MOOCs and Open Education
provides a critical analysis of
these massive open online courses and other open education resource subjects.
This new book
also researches the
major controversies associated with
these massive open online courses and OERS.
